For the 2026 school year, there are 9 public elementary schools serving 3,369 students in 97322, OR.
The top-ranked public elementary schools in 97322, OR are Timber Ridge School, Oak Elementary School and Three Lakes High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public elementary schools in zipcode 97322 have an average math proficiency score of 27% (versus the Oregon public elementary school average of 33%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 44% statewide average). Elementary schools in 97322, OR have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Oregon public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 41%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is equal to the Oregon public elementary school average of 41% (majority Hispanic).
